首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>HTTP Date报头背后的原理是什么?

HTTP Date报头背后的原理是什么?
EN

Stack Overflow用户
提问于 2009-10-23 06:05:45
回答 3查看 19.7K关注 0票数 42

我已经阅读了RFC 2616,但我仍然想知道日期字段是用来做什么的。有一个Last-Modified字段,除了提供元数据外,它实际上还有一个含义,即用于缓存(‘If-Modified- field’)。

但是,在单独的日期标题中将信息加倍又有什么用呢?

EN

Stack Overflow用户

发布于 2020-01-21 18:43:58

请考虑不使用Date标头,因为它在“禁止标头名称”的列表中。

中的以下描述可能会有所帮助:

禁止的标头名称是不能以编程方式修改的任何HTTP标头的名称;具体地说,是HTTP请求标头名称(与禁止的响应标头名称形成对比)。

禁止修改此类标头,因为用户代理保留对它们的完全控制。以Sec-开头的名称是为创建新的标题而保留的,这些标题不受使用Fetch的API的影响,这些API允许开发人员控制标题,如XMLHttpRequest。

禁止的标头名称以Proxy-或Sec-开头,或者是以下名称之一:

  • Accept-Charset
  • List item
  • Accept-Encoding
  • Access-Control-Request-Headers
  • Access-Control-Request-Method
  • Connection
  • Content-Length
  • Cookie
  • Cookie2
  • Date
  • DNT
  • Expect
  • Host
  • Keep-Alive
  • Origin
  • Proxy-
  • Sec-
  • Referer
  • TE
  • Trailer
  • Transfer-Encoding
  • Upgrade
  • Via
票数 -5
EN
查看全部 3 条回答
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/1610254

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档